Gateway Pioneers Plastic Waste Diversion and Recycling for Trees Program

An Entrego facility does more than recycling its waste.

Fulfilling its commitment on becoming a more environment-conscious Entrego facility, Gateway started sending its plastic waste to Green Antz’s Eco Hub since October 2021. Their plastic waste that would otherwise have ended up in a landfill or incinerator will now be shredded to be used in making eco-bricks, eco pavers and eco-casts and other building materials alike.

After its diversion of plastics, Gateway then pioneered the Recycling for Trees program last December, in partnership with Smart Recycle. Under the partnership, Smart Recycle agrees to provide free transport every Saturday and sponsor a tree for every 2000 kilos of cartons they buy cater from Gateway. The location of the tree planting site will be identified soon.

As of today, through the efforts of our Gateway eco-warriors team - Sherly Sison (Associate Manager), Ellalyn Achivida (Ops Supervisor) and Francisco Ojeda (Safety Officer) - the facility now qualifies for one (1) tree, contributed P9,500 back to our coffers, recycled three thousand seven hundred seventy kilos (3,770kg) of used cartons and diverted six hundred seventy-one kilos (671kg) of plastics away from landfills.

Mindanao and Visayas Hubs also joined the Recycling for Trees Program!


What started out as a pilot project in Gateway has now spread to Mindanao and Visayas hubs through the collective action of our regional managers, associate managers and Hub OICs. MindanaoONE team fully supports this program and we will always strive to Reduce, Reuse, Recycle, and lend a hand to plant trees to save our future. We can’t change the past, but we can change the future! – Frances Rivera, Area Manager, Delivery Operations North Mindanao, on behalf of MindanaoONE Team

This program will officially commence in our Zamboanga, Cagayan de Oro, and Koronadal hubs on 12 February 2022. Dates for the remaining 13 Mindanao hubs will follow soon.

In our Visayas Region, two (2) hubs in Cebu had already started the program with Smart Recycle last 5 February 2022. Other participating hubs in Visayas includes Tagbillaran, Iloilo and Bacolod.
